    Description: 
We are using a Solr Core with field names defined like "f_1179014266_txt". The 
number in the middle of the name differs for each field we use. For language 
specific fields we are adding an language specific extension e.g. 
"f_1179014267_txt_fr", "f_1179014268_txt_de", "f_1179014269_txt_en" and so on.

We are having the following odd issue within the french "_fr" field only:

- The saved value which had been added with no problem to the Solr index is 
"FRaoo".
- When searching within the Solr query tool for "f_1197829839_txt_fr:\*FRao\*" 
it returns the items matching the term - OK

{code:json}
{
  "responseHeader":{
    "status":0,
    "QTime":1,
    "params":{
      "q":"f_1197829839_txt_fr:*FRao*",
      "indent":"on",
      "wt":"json",
      "_":"1505808887827"}},
  "response":{"numFound":1,"start":0,"docs":[
      {
        "id":"129",
        "f_1197829834_txt_en":"EnAir",
        "f_1197829822_txt_de":"Lufti",
        "f_1197829835_txt_fr":"FRaoi",
        "f_1197829836_txt_it":"ITAir",
        "f_1197829799_txt":["Lufti"],
        "f_1197829838_txt_en":"EnAir",
        "f_1197829839_txt_fr":"FRaoo",
        "f_1197829840_txt_it":"ITAir",
        "_version_":1578520424165146624}]
  }}
{code}

- When searching for "f_1197829839_txt_fr:\*FRaoo\*" NO item is found - Wrong

{code:json}
{
  "responseHeader":{
    "status":0,
    "QTime":1,
    "params":{
      "q":"f_1197829839_txt_fr:*FRaoo*",
      "indent":"on",
      "wt":"json",
      "_":"1505808887827"}},
  "response":{"numFound":0,"start":0,"docs":[]
  }}
{code}
- When searching for "f_1197829839_txt_fr:FRaoo" (no wildcards) the matching 
items are found - OK
{code:json}
{
  "responseHeader":{
    "status":0,
    "QTime":1,
    "params":{
      "q":"f_1197829839_txt_fr:FRaoo",
      "indent":"on",
      "wt":"json",
      "_":"1505808887827"}},
  "response":{"numFound":1,"start":0,"docs":[
      {
        "id":"129",
        "f_1197829834_txt_en":"EnAir",
        "f_1197829822_txt_de":"Lufti",
        "f_1197829835_txt_fr":"FRaoi",
        "f_1197829836_txt_it":"ITAir",
        "f_1197829799_txt":["Lufti"],
        "f_1197829838_txt_en":"EnAir",
        "f_1197829839_txt_fr":"FRaoo",
        "f_1197829840_txt_it":"ITAir",
        "_version_":1578520424165146624}]
  }}
{code}
 If we save exact the same value into a different language field e.g. ending on 
"_en", means "f_1197829834_txt_en", then the search 
"f_1197829834_txt_en:\*FRaoo\*" find all items correctly!
We have no idea what's wrong here and we even recreated the index and can 
reproduce this problem all the time. I can only see that the value starts with 
"FR" and the field extension ends with "fr" but this is not problem for "en", 
"de" etc. All fields are used in the same way and have the same field 
properties.
Any help or ideas are highly appreciated.
